Best computer port elizabeth near me in Port Elizabeth, South Africa
P.o.box 162 | Port Elizabeth
Greenacres | Port Elizabeth, 6045
Struanway | Port Elizabeth, 5575
139 Russell Road | Port Elizabeth, 6001
3 Cape Road | Port Elizabeth, 6000
139 Russell Road | Port Elizabeth, 6001
139 Russell Road | Port Elizabeth, 6001
3 Cape Road | Port Elizabeth, 6000
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ood